WebNov 15, 2024 · One of the first steps to building a newsletter is outlining specific aims for that campaign. Objectives could be things like improving your open rate and click through rate, gaining new subscribers, or creating your best email yet in terms of conversions. Whatever your aim is, try to make sure it’s specific and measurable.
